The Senior Director establishes and maintains comprehensive oversight frameworks that ensure INL meets its commitments to DOE while fostering a culture of continuous improvement, transparency, and mission excellence. This position will report to the Deputy Laboratory Director for Management and Operations.
** Primary
Responsibilities Include:
*** Provide leadership for INL's integrated governance and assurance functions under the Prime Contract with the Department of Energy.
* Serve as a senior advisor to Laboratory leadership on contractor performance obligations, regulatory compliance, enterprise risk management, and organizational accountability.
* Establish and maintain comprehensive oversight frameworks ensuring INL meets its commitments to DOE while fostering a culture of continuous improvement, transparency, and mission excellence.
* Integrate multiple critical organizational functions including Prime Contract Management, Requirements Management, Contractor Assurance, Enterprise Risk Management, and Internal Investigations.
* Ensure these functions operate cohesively to provide Laboratory leadership with comprehensive visibility into performance, compliance status, emerging risks, and organizational health.
* Serve as the primary interface with DOE- for the Prime Contract and Contractor Assurance.
* Work with executive management to recommend and establish strategic plans and objectives, make final decisions on implementation, and ensure operational effectiveness.
